One reason the japanese translators asked whether TRP had ever visited Japan was
because of his letter to an early agent speaking of wanting to do a book containing a Godzilla-like monster.......(Godzilla, or Gojira in Japan, originated fictionally, mythically, as a response
to the atomic bombs---and radiation effects----dropped on the two japanese cities, it seems)
So, one---I---can see it fitting into some parts of AtD had TRP wanted to........[Tungaska Event we just passed thru, for example).
